Every company incorporated in the United Kingdom is legally required to maintain a Registered Office Address in the UK. This is the official address listed with Companies House and is used by government agencies, HMRC (UK tax authority), and legal bodies to send official correspondence.
Whether you’re a UK-based entrepreneur or an international business owner forming a UK company, our Registered Office Address Service ensures you stay compliant and maintain a professional business presence.
A Registered Office Address is the legal home of your company in the UK. It:
Appears on the public record at Companies House
Is used for all official government and legal correspondence
Must be a physical address in the UK — not a PO Box
Can be different from your actual place of business
Our service provides a prestigious UK business address you can use for incorporation and ongoing compliance — without needing to rent or own physical office space.
Your company will be officially registered at our London or other premium UK address.
We receive mail from:
Companies House
HM Revenue & Customs (HMRC)
UK Courts & Legal Authorities
We forward scanned copies to you via email or post (your choice).
We keep your address valid and compliant with Companies House regulations year after year.
No UK residency required. We assist non-residents and foreign companies in setting up and maintaining their UK presence.
UK-based limited companies or LLPs
Non-UK residents registering a UK company
Businesses wanting a professional UK presence
Amazon UK or eCommerce sellers requiring a UK entity
Entrepreneurs needing a UK address for tax or legal reasons
Copyright @ 2025 Seuor. All rights reserved.